Podcast Description
Every family has a story worth telling.
The Polsky Family Business Podcast shines a light on the inspiring, often unconventional journeys of family-owned businesses. Through rich conversations and reflections, we explore how families navigate challenges, build legacies, and redefine what it means to achieve generational success.
Hosted by Jamie Shah, a family business leader, educator, and entrepreneur, each episode connects authenticity with aspiration, helping listeners feel seen, understood, and inspired.

In this episode, Jamie sits down with Elana Schulman, third-generation leader of Eli’s Cheesecake, to explore what it means to carry a family name—and a legacy—into the future. From the steakhouse where it all began to the values that still guide the business today, Elana shares stories of innovation, identity, and what it’s like to grow up inside one of Chicago’s most beloved food brands. From launching a non-dairy cheesecake to reimagining what leadership looks like in the third generation, Elana Schulman brings humor, heart, and insight to this episode.
